The app takes a standard video and splits it into four sides. You place your Android phone on top of a plastic pyramid made of CD cases or a dedicated hologram screen. The "Flash" aspect refers to an overlay or brightness boost that compensates for the light lost when reflecting off the plastic film.

What is a Holo Flash Projector App? Before we dive into the download links, let’s clarify what this technology actually does. A true holo flash projector app does not actually project lasers into the air (not yet, anyway). Instead, it utilizes a "Pepper's Ghost" illusion.
